RJA #11a: Introduction

People need to be aware of not only things that are going wrong in our culture but people need to be educated on what is going on in other cultures. Normal Lear once said, “It seems to me that any full grown, mature adult would have a desire to be responsible, to help where he can in a world that needs so very much, that threatens us so very much.” If people understand the issues that are going on around everyone then maybe we can help people who are being put through torture, poverty, etc. Everyone is raised differently; however it is inhumane for our culture to stand back and watch pure torture happen to those around us. Culturally a woman who has gone through Female Genital Mutilation is more desirable in countries like Africa and Asia. Mothers stand by their daughters when they are being mutilated. Female Genital Mutilation originated in Africa in the 5th century. Female genital mutilation is torture. It is a crime against the body and the mind of the women affected.
